Abstract

Results from the first application of a EUROBALL Cluster module in (γ, γ′) experiments at the S-DALINAC are reported. The scissors mode was observed for the first time in a γ-soft nucleus, 196Pt. A combination of detailed spectroscopy of 165Ho and 169Tm with a fluctuation analysis technique demonstrates that the total scissors mode strength in odd-mass nuclei is comparable to that in the even neighbours, but fragmentation is so strong that large parts are below detection thresholds. The search for the spin M1 resonance in the heavy deformed nucleus 154Sm gives a hint on rather large cancellations of spin and orbital contributions. The fine structure of the E1 response in the semimagic 140Ce below particle threshold is fully resolved and successfully interpreted in the microscopic quasiparticle-phonon model.
